Yes John, in my previous reply I probably should have said 2805/985. The 985 is a model in Denon's "specialty audio" line which is sold at a different group of retailers at a slightly lower price. It's exactly identical to the 2805(but only available in silver). The best deal for shipment to Canada that I'm aware of is this , which should make an outstanding buy.

So far as the DAC discussion goes, this is something that was useful many years ago, but as Alan and others have pointed out, DACs are now a mature technology and should be of no concern to the consumer. Equipment makers have a choice of excellent DACs available at low cost(as little as $1 apiece in OEM quantities) from suppliers such as Analog Devices, Cirrus Logic, Texas Instruments(Burr-Brown), Wolfson and others. They pick what meets their specs at the best price they can negotiate and there's no audible difference, although slight measurable differences still exist. The 2805/985 in particular uses the very fine Analog Devices AD1835A codec(an acronym for COder/DECoder, combining both ADCs and DACs on one chip), which you can see described here on the data sheet.

The Denon has a setting for tone defeat. With that bypassed and there silly room EQ off they sound more or less the same. With tone on and everything at 0, the Denon is brighter. There is no doubt there but it's not a huge change but I hear it. The big change is when you get going on the volume, the Denon has far more control and composure.

This is a nice unit. It does almost everything well. I have been playing with it for about 7 hours now. Is it heads and tails above my 800?............no. It has more power and a few more bells and whistles but the Onkyo holds its own. Biggest compliment I pay the 3805 is exactly what I said above. I could run this all on it's own and be very happy.
